Hair analysis is widely recognized as a significant means for identifying drug and alcohol intake. It records prolonged substance history by embedding biomarkers within the strands of hair as they grow. Hair samples, taken near the scalp, can reveal a detection period of around three months for various substances. Collection is uncomplicated, tampering is quite challenging, and transport is straightforward.
A sample measuring 1.5 inches consisting of approximately 200 hair strands (roughly the dimension of a #2 pencil) nearest the scalp yields 100mg, optimal for both screening and confirmation tests. For assessments like EtG, additional tests, or those beyond 10 panels, a 150mg sample is advisable. Utilizing a jeweler's scale to weigh the specimen is suggested. If scalp hair is not an option, an equivalent portion of body hair may be used. 'Head hair' specifically refers to scalp hair, while 'body hair' includes all other types such as facial and axillary hair.
Process Overview
The four fundamental steps in laboratory drug test analysis include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
Accessioning encompasses the primary processing of a test sample within the laboratory framework. This step verifies the appropriate sealing and transport of the sample, assigns a unique L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and completes any additional manual data inputs not covered by an electronic custody system.
Screening offers an initial assessment for substance presence. Although cost-efficient for negating substance usage in most cases, positive screenings require further confirmation for legal acceptability. Presumptive positives in the Screening phase need secondary validation.
For presumptively positive samples in Screening, additional hair is sourced from the primary sample for the Extraction phase. Here, substances are isolated from hair at notably low concentrations compared to other methods like urine or oral fluids, emphasizing why this testing method is considered intricate.
Positives from screening undergo Confirmation via G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S. All presumptive positive specimens are cleansed before confirmation if needed. The entire lab protocol, from Accessioning to Confirmation, is evaluated under both CAP (College of American Pathologists) guidelines and ISO/IEC 17025 accreditation.

Note: Commonly termed "hair follicle tests", the procedure evaluates the hair strand itself, not the follicle under the skin.
